How Much Does a Hyundai Spare Key Cost?

If you lose your Hyundai car keys, you have several options to think about. You can call an automotive locksmith, tow the keys to the dealership, or purchase an online replacement key.

The dealership is the safest option, but they will charge you more than an auto locksmith. You can also purchase a blank key, to have it programmed and cut by an auto locksmith.

Cost of a transponder key

Hyundai is a relatively new company in the auto industry however, it has rapidly become a household name. The company's popularity has resulted in an increase in demand for car keys. If you've misplaced your Hyundai car keys, you can purchase an online replacement key or from your local locksmith.

The majority of newer Hyundai vehicles have a transponder key that stops the car from starting until the correct key is used. You will need the Vehicle Identification Number along with the model and year of your car to be able to purchase the replacement. The VIN is required to ensure that the new key is compatible with your car's security system and allows you to start it.

A locksmith from your car can create a replacement Hyundai key for you at a cheaper cost than the dealership. They'll need to know the make and model of your vehicle and have the tools needed to program the new key. Some locksmiths provide mobile services for most Hyundai models.

It's important to make copies of your Hyundai keys. This copy won't allow you to start your vehicle however it will open your doors and allow you to access your trunk. A service key costs as little as $5, but is worth it if you are worried about losing your original.
